Job Overview
We are looking for a highly organized and detail-oriented HR Administrator to support end-to-end HR and recruitment administration.
This role plays a critical part in employee onboarding, personnel records management, and cross-functional coordination, ensuring HR processes run smoothly and efficiently.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ment, enjoy working with systems and data, and have a strong sense of responsibility, this role is for you.
Key Responsibilities:
Process, verify, and maintain personnel documentation including contracts, licences, training certificates, and employee records
Support employee onboarding using SAP SuccessFactors (Manage Pending Recruits, Manual Labour Hire, EC Uploads, profile updates)
Coordinate with Recruitment Administrators for system access, reference checks, document retrieval, and uploads
Maintain accurate employee data including personal details, allowances, changes in conditions, and termination records
Liaise with HR Managers, Recruitment Team Leaders, Recruitment Advisors, and HSE teams to support workforce requirements
Gather and consolidate personnel documentation from Recruitment, HSE, and Training & Development teams
Conduct and manage reference checks using Business Connect and other approved systems
Handle ad hoc HR and administrative tasks as required
Support operational needs by completing tasks accurately and within agreed deadlines
